Output 63d96b9f75cb25b400a3b0896dfe2825e98b6f45fd578bb8bd65061fb9036eea:78

value
570000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ef93cac1de280c44c1e88036e7ccaf08f3ddf46a OP_EQUAL
address
3PXnUAHLUEGQopasiv6Bt5DaHLcVx5x9fx
transaction
63d96b9f75cb25b400a3b0896dfe2825e98b6f45fd578bb8bd65061fb9036eea
spent
true